LynnBlakeGolf Forums - View Single Post - Squaring the Face (again) Thread: Squaring the Face (again) View Single Post #7 06-22-2006, 08:59 AM Mathew Inactive User Join Date: Jan 2005 Posts: 833 An interesting observation is how much roll back to vertical a player has from release point is dependant on the angle of the inclined plane and where the vertical plane of the hinge action intersects it. The more flat the plane angle the more accumulator 3 you will need in conjunction to load both itself and #2. The hinge action plane from the point of the left shoulder isn't affected by the left shoulders own movement - global application rather than local. With the swingers horizontal hinge action - accumulator 3 will be loaded the least when the vertical plane intersects the inclined plane parallel to the plane line....the most when it goes through the plane line at 90 degrees.... Accumulator 3 is constantly adjusting in accordance to the plane and how far out of line it is with the vertical plane of the hinge action. For any given point on the inclined plane - maximum no.3 will always be when no.2 is fully loaded also.... Last edited by Mathew : 06-22-2006 at 09:10 AM.
